The klapa of the island of Rab

The best explanation of the klapa was written by the father of the klapa among the Croats, maestro Ljubo Stipišić Delmata,
“They are everywhere today, not just in Dalmatia and the coast but also all over our homeland and in the Diaspora (Australia, Canada and elsewhere) – more than three hundred traditional male and female singing groups popularly known as klapa.

Melodies and songs remain in the world even after the death of their original progenitors – some of them unknown, some known – to seek beauty and truth through their harmonies. And as a song it only fully begins to live – indeed it is only truly born some distant day in the future – after its birth and after the death of its anonymous progenitors... That is why in these songs there live not only its original creators, but all the generations that, inspired, carried them through and on, and those generations which are yet to be born and which will take up the legacy when the time comes. Here in the song are the people, our unknown ancestors, our honoured forefathers, singers from the sooty hearth of this Dalmatian, coastal Croatian people."
